        Technology Innovation in The Chinese Battery Industry

        簡報大綱

        • Reminding: What We can Takeaway from Observation Chinese Battery Industry?
        • The Battery Related Part in The 15th Five-Year Plan
        • Updates of the New Chinese Government Policies and Regulation for xEV Batteries in 2026
        • GB/T 43568-2026: First GB for Solid-state Battery
        • Chinese EVB Installed Capacity Status: 769.7GWh in 2025, >40% YoY Growth, 124.9GWh in 26Q1
        • Updates of the Chinese xEV Battery Technologies in 2026Q1-Leading Companies
        • Updates of the Chinese xEV Battery Technologies in 2026Q1-CIBF Released
        • 2023: CATL’s 4C LFP cell
        • CATL”Shenxing PLUS”Disclosed on Beijing Auto Show 2024
        • CATL Tech Day 2026: 10C Supercharging has become the Standard Configuration
        • CATL Gen2 SIB: Naxin Gen 2
        • Sunwanda: 6C Discharge & CATL for 10C for XPENG
        • How to Do 4C LFP cell
        • How to Design 5C SuperFastCharge Cell?
        • Preparing the 6C to 10C Superfastcharging Material Series
        • Example: BTR 6C T-Max AG & T-Pro NG
        • LFP Installed Capacity in 2025=409.0GWh, Occupied 74.6%
        • BYD Blade Battery: LFP Battery Energy Density Improvement
        • BYD Blade Battery: Materials Development Route-LMFP
        • Chinese Semi Solid-state Battery: More than 31.7GWh have been Installed on NEV in 2025
        • CASIP 2025: 3 Steps of the Next SSB Development
        • NIO ET7 is Equipped with a 150KWh Semi-solid-state Battery with a Range of 1,070 km
        • Solid-state Electrolyte Direct Molding Technology Gen1
        • Solid-state Electrolyte Direct Molding Technology Gen2
        • CATL Gen2 SIB: Naxin Gen 2
        • Conclusion: How we can do and what we can learn?
